Director of Social Services

The

Social Services

Director is responsible for implementing and documenting a plan of care related to the resident’s social/emotional needs in the electronic medical record. The

Social Services

Director collaborates with the nursing, MDS, and rehabilitation departments to facilitate discharge plans for residents. The

Social Services

Director informs and educates the staff, residents, families, and responsible parties of the resident’s personal and property rights, as well as rights related to health services. The

Social Services

Director maintains updated resources for residents and families regarding community resources and services, as well as service agencies and organizations. This role maintains a record of all reported concerns, assists in resolving them, and ensures appropriate follow-up and documentation. The

Social Services

Director is easily accessible to residents, families, and staff, providing timely referrals to appropriate agencies for assistance (e.g., conservatorship application, Medicaid application).
